  2. Report Description The integrated quantum optical circuits market is expected to witness market growth at a rate of 11.20% in the forecast period of 2021 to 2028. The rise in the demand for effective and enhanced alternative for conventional technology is escalating the growth of integrated quantum optical circuits market. Integrated Quantum Optical Circuits can be referred to as a device that combines multiple optical devices to create a single photonic circuit. This device utilizes the light as an alternative to the electricity for the signal computing and processing. It comprises of complex circuit configurations because of integration of several optical devices involving multiplexers, amplifiers, modulators, and others into a small compact circuit. It allows effective electrical to optical conversions and permits the devices to work at high temperature.   4. Market Segmentation The integrated quantum optical circuits market is segmented on the basis of material type, component and application. The growth among segments helps you analyse niche pockets of growth and strategies to approach the market and determine your core application areas and the difference in your target markets. • On the basis of material type, the integrated quantum optical circuits market is segmented into indium phosphide, silica glass, silicon photonics, lithium niobate and gallium arsenide. • On the basis of component, the integrated quantum optical circuits market is segmented into waveguides, directional coupler, active components, light sources and detectors. • On the basis of application, the integrated quantum optical circuits market is segmented into optical fiber communication, optical sensors, bio medical, quantum computing and others.
